Become an Assistant Crown Attorney with the Ontario Ministry of the Attorney General in Belleville. This temporary role focuses on prosecution duties, case management, and legal advocacy within criminal law.The Ministry seeks two Assistant Crown Attorneys for a temporary period, emphasizing the prosecution of criminal cases. Required skills include conducting hearings, appeals, and managing criminal cases effectively.
